What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1903.19(c)(1): The employer did not certify to OSHA, within 10 calendar days after the abatement date, that the cited violation had been abated:  (a)  On or about 01/17/2019, the employer failed to submit certification of corrective action for citation 1, item 2 issued on 06/07/2018 that became a final order on 07/05/2018 with an abatement due date of 07/03/2018.

29 CFR 1910.141(b)(1)(i): Potable water was not provided in all places of employment, for drinking, washing of the person, cooking, washing of foods, washing of cooking or eating utensils, washing of food preparation or processing premises, and personal service rooms:  1) Men restroom: On or about March 14, 2018, the employer exposed employees to sanitation hazards in that the sink in the restroom was not working.  Employees did not have access to running water to wash hands.

29 CFR 1910.179(j)(3): A complete periodic inspection of crane(s) had not been conducted in the past 12 months:  1) Shop Area: On or about March 14, 2018, and at times prior, the employer exposed employees to struck-by hazards, in that the annual crane inspection on the Southern Monorail one ton crane serial 8049 has not been conducted.  Employees were using the crane that was shooting out sparks and missing the safety latch on the hook.  2) Shop Area: On or about March 14, 2018, and at times prior, the employer exposed employees to struck-by hazards, in that the annual crane inspection on the Southern Monorail one ton crane serial 8048 has not been conducted.  The employees used the crane to hoist equipment.

29 CFR 1910.37(a)(3): Exit route(s) were not kept free and unobstructed:  1) Shop Area: On or about March 14, 2018, the employer exposed employees to a fire hazard in that the exit door was obstructed with a trailer tire; in case of a fire the employees could not access the door immediately.
